My card today for the Sketch Challenge on Splitcoast, and we all know that I can’t miss many of those (I did last week, SORRY Roxie), using one of those combinations – Purely Pomegranate and Groovy Guava!

SC133

The main images were stamped first in Groovy Guava, rock and rolled in Purely Pomegranate, and then stamped. I stamped the flairs in Groovy Guava and then went back and stamped again in Purely Pomegranate. Oh my how I love this over stamping looks! As you can see, I also got some of the new ribbon in my order – oh my! I was going to use just a one layer card of the Groovy Guava, and after I stamped it and laid it out, I just couldn’t leave it alone – nope, had to cut off the panel and stick it on a card base of the Pomegranate. All three of the panels are raised on mounting tape too!

Stamps: Priceless

Ink: Groovy Guava, Purely Pomegranate

Paper: Neenah Solar White Cover, Groovy Guava, Purely Pomegranate

Accessories: Dauber, Mounting Tape, Ribbon, Brads
